@charset 'UTF-8';.wrap{background:#ececec}#google_translate_element{position:absolute;top:21px;right:2rem;z-index:100;text-align:center}.header-area{width:100%;background:#fff}.header-block{position:relative;overflow:hidden;margin:0 auto;height:116px}.header-logo{position:absolute;top:24px;left:2rem;z-index:100}.header-logo a{display:block}.header-logo a img{width:170px;height:71px}.header-time{position:absolute;top:22px;right:160px;display:inline-block;padding:6px 3.25em;border-radius:18px;background:#0050a0;color:#fff;font-size:12px;font-family:roboto, sans-serif;line-height:1.2}.header-time2{position:absolute;top:51px;right:165px;display:inline-block;word-wrap:break-word;font-size:10px;line-height:1.2}.sp-btn-img,.sp-navi,.sp-navi-block,.sp-navi-btn{display:none}.header-navi{position:absolute;bottom:.5rem;left:0;width:100%;font-size:0}.header-navi-block{overflow:hidden;margin:0 auto}.header-navi-block .header-menu{display:inline-block;padding:.5rem 0;width:calc(100% / 5);color:#0950a0;text-align:center;text-decoration:none;font-weight:700;font-size:1.4rem;line-height:1.25}.header-menu p:first-child{font-size:10px}a.header-menu:hover{color:#3298ff;text-decoration:none}.sp-navi-list{display:none}.pc-navi{padding:0;width:100%;background:#0950a0;font-size:0}.pc-navi-block{overflow:hidden;margin:0 auto}.pc-navi-block a{display:inline-block;width:calc(100% / 4);background:#0950a0;color:#fff;text-align:center;text-decoration:none}.pc-navi-block a:hover{background:#3298ff;color:#fff;text-decoration:none}.pc-navi-block a p{overflow:hidden;margin:0 1px;padding:13px 0;-o-text-overflow:ellipsis;text-overflow:ellipsis;white-space:nowrap;font-weight:700;font-size:14px;line-height:1}.pc-navi-block a:first-child{display:none}.pc-navi-block a p:first-child{margin:5px 1px 0;padding:0 0 4px;border-bottom:2px solid #fff;font-weight:400;font-size:10px}.local-navi{margin:2rem auto 0}.local-navi ul{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-flow:wrap;flex-flow:wrap}.local-navi ul li{width:33.3%;text-align:center;font-weight:700;font-size:1rem}.local-navi ul li a{display:block;padding:1em 0;color:#fff;line-height:1.25}.local-navi ul li a:hover{background:#3298ff}#shopping.local-navi ul li a{font-size:1rem}.main{-webkit-box-flex:1;-ms-flex:1;flex:1;margin:0 auto;padding:0 3rem;width:100%}.contents{margin-top:3rem;padding:5rem 0 3rem;background:#fff}.title{margin-bottom:3rem;padding:0 3rem;color:#555;font-weight:700;font-size:3rem;line-height:1}footer{position:relative;margin-top:auto}.bottom-area{margin:3em 0 0;padding:1.5em 2rem 1.15em;width:100%;background:#fff}.bottom-navi{overflow:hidden;margin:0 auto}.bottom-navi ul{display:-webkit-box;display:-ms-flexbox;display:flex;margin:0 auto;width:530px;text-align:center;font-size:13px}.bottom-navi ul li:not(:first-child){margin-left:2em}.bottom-navi ul li a:hover{color:#3298ff}.scroll-top{position:absolute;bottom:100px;left:0;z-index:1000;width:100%}.scroll-top p{padding:.5rem 3rem;text-align:right}.scroll-top a{color:#0950a0;font-weight:bold;font-size:18px}.scroll-top a:hover{color:#3298ff}.footer-area{width:100%;background:#0950a0;color:#fff}.footer-sp{display:none}.footer-block{overflow:hidden;margin:0 auto}.footer-block ul{position:relative;width:100%;height:3em}.footer-block li{padding:1.35em 0 .65em;font-size:12px}.footer-block li:first-of-type{display:none}.footer-block li:last-of-type{text-align:center}@media screen and (max-width:750px){.header-time,.header-time2{display:none}}